A woman gave birth in a Waymo vehicle while en route to a San Francisco hospital on Monday night, the autonomous vehicle company confirmed.
A Waymo spokesperson told NBC Bay Area that the mother was heading to UCSF Medical Center in the vehicle when she gave birth. Advertisement
The company said its rider support team detected "unusual activity" and initiated a call to check on the rider before calling 911.
Waymo said the new mother, baby and vehicle arrived safely at the hospital ahead of emergency services.
After the mother and newborn were safely delivered, the Waymo vehicle was taken out of service to be cleaned, the company said.
